**Checklist item 7 — Verify partner SFTP drop.** After the Fernhaven release is tagged, confirm the nightly export lands in the Calloway Mutual drop folder by 02:30 local. Check that the manifest row count matches the batch summary and that the checksum file is present. If the drop is empty or partial, escalate to the data-exchange rotation before partners open tickets. Support agents verifying a customer's file should quote the build token below.

trace token, fafog-kageg: htk4_98e6

# Slimming constants for the Burrowbuild image pipeline.
# Support folks: if a customer image blows past the size cap, these are
# the knobs we tweak. Layer squash depth and cache-prune aggressiveness
# trade size against rebuild speed, so change one at a time and note it
# in the runbook. Current defaults are as follows.

tuning constants:
QUOTAS = {
    "druwyn": 5,
    "holix": 5,
    "zorath": 5,
    "holwyn": 10,
}

## String extraction script

The `pullstrings` script scans the Lanternwick codebase for translatable strings and pushes new entries to the Phrasedock service. It runs nightly, but if the on-call pager fires on a missed sync, run it manually from the repo root. The script needs network access to Phrasedock's internal endpoint and a valid service credential in the environment; it exits immediately otherwise. For manual runs against staging, use the key below.

gateway credential: kto3_qfe

Background for new team members: our current build pulls toolchains from whatever is installed on the agent, so outputs differ between machines and caching is unreliable. The migration pins compiler versions, vendors all third-party dependencies, and sandboxes network access during builds. Expected outcome: byte-identical artifacts across agents and roughly 40% faster incremental builds. Please review the migration doc before picking up subtasks. The first fully hermetic build token is recorded below.

build token for kagaf-hahof: htk14_9d3d4d26d7d8de